Ticket: GarageSense occupancy feed drops to zero during shift rollover. Every night around the counter reset window, the Larkfield Deck feed publishes a brief burst of zero-occupancy frames, which downstream dashboards interpret as a full garage clearing. Root cause appears to be the aggregator flushing its ring buffer before the new counter baseline arrives. Proposed fix: hold publication until two consistent frames are seen. Reproduced reliably in staging. The failing staging run is identified by the trace token that follows.

pipeline stamp: htk31_f769b577b3028a4e9958e5bb8d1259a

Welcome to on-call for the Glimmerpane design system! Our snapshot tests live in the `snapcheck` suite and run on every merge to main. If a UI component changes visually, the diff bot flags it — usually it's an intentional tweak, so just approve the new baseline. If it's 2am and snapshots are failing across the board, it's almost always a font-loading race, not your problem. To unlock the baseline store and re-approve snapshots in bulk, use the recovery passphrase below.

recovery phrase for tahag-taguf: wenix-caswyn

CHANGELOG — Hushgate alert deduplicator, changed defaults. The correlation window now spans 10 minutes rather than 2, and fingerprinting includes the alert's source cluster to prevent cross-cluster collapsing observed during the Lindqvist incident review. Suppressed duplicates are still counted and exposed as a metric. The new default configuration shipping with this release follows.

config for tajof-tajef:
ralael:
  pin: 3468
  metrics_host: metrics.ralael.lumicsys.internal
  tenant: casath
  seal: seal_c325d9c6